P0606 VW Code Meaning
The P0606 code in Volkswagen vehicles signals a problem with the Engine Control Module (ECM). This module is the car's main computer, handling important tasks like fuel injection and ignition timing. If there's a problem with it, the car might not run well.
Several things can cause the P0606 code in Volkswagens. Water might get into the ECM, causing electrical issues. Wires connected to the ECM might be faulty, leading to poor connections. The ECM can also overheat, which harms its parts.
Sometimes, the software in the ECM gets corrupted and doesn't work right.
Fixing this issue often means changing the ECM processor, which can cost between $500 and $1500. This depends on the model of the car and labor costs.
If the ECM isn't working right, it can lead to more emissions, worse gas mileage, and engine problems.

Causes of VW P0606 Fault Code
The P0606 error code in Volkswagen vehicles points to problems with the engine control module (ECM), which can affect how the engine runs.
Here's a breakdown of what might cause this code to appear:
- Water Damage: If water gets into the ECM, it can cause rust and damage. This often happens if there's a leak in the car or if the ECM is exposed to wet conditions.
- Electrical Problems: Issues like broken wires or bad connections can stop the ECM from talking to other parts of the car. This can lead to the ECM not working correctly.
- Overheating: If the engine runs too hot for too long, it can harm the ECM. This might cause the ECM to fail and show the P0606 code.
- Software Issues: Problems with the ECM's software, like bad updates or corrupted files, can also cause it to malfunction.
These problems can disrupt the ECM's work, leading to engine performance issues.
Identifying and fixing these causes is key to ensuring the ECM works well.
Tools Needed to Diagnose
To find and fix the P0606 error code in Volkswagen cars, you'll need some special tools.
An OBD-II scanner is the main tool. It helps you read error codes and check if the engine control module (ECM) has any problems. The scanner shows the P0606 code and helps find other issues that might be affecting how the car runs.
A multimeter is another tool you'll use. It checks if the wires and connections in the ECM are working properly by testing voltage and continuity.
You'll also need a wiring diagram specific to the Volkswagen model you're working on. This diagram helps you see if there are any wiring problems causing the P0606 code.
Finally, a software update tool might be needed to program a new ECM processor to make sure it works with the car.

How to Fix P0606 VW Error Code – Step by Step
Step 1:
Utilize an OBD-II scanner to confirm the presence of the P0606 error code in your Volkswagen vehicle. Ensure it is specifically linked to the ECM processor to avoid unnecessary repairs.
Step 2:
Conduct a thorough inspection of the wiring and connectors associated with the ECM. Check for any signs of damage, corrosion, or loose connections, which can impede communication and trigger error codes.
Step 3:
If any wiring or connector issues are detected, repair or replace the affected components before proceeding. Ensure all connections are secure and free of corrosion or damage.
Step 4:
If the wiring and connectors appear intact, replace the faulty ECM processor. Install a new ECM that is properly reprogrammed to align with the vehicle's specifications for seamless integration and functionality.
Step 5:
After installing the new ECM, clear the error codes using the scanner and reset the ECM. Conduct a test drive to verify that the issue has been resolved and that the vehicle operates smoothly.
Common Diagnosis Mistakes
When diagnosing the P0606 Volkswagen error code, it's easy to miss other fault codes. This can lead to errors in identifying the problem with the Engine Control Module (ECM). A complete diagnostic check helps in understanding all issues since multiple codes can reveal more about what's going on.
Problems like bad fuel usage or rough engine idle shouldn't only be blamed on the ECM. Check other things like sensors or wiring that might be causing issues.
Look at the ECM and its connections to see if there's any corrosion or damage. These can cause the processor to fail. Also, if you replace the ECM, make sure it's programmed correctly for the car. Otherwise, it might not communicate properly with other systems.
To avoid mistakes, follow these steps:
- Do a full scan for all fault codes.
- Check external parts like sensors and wiring.
- Look at the ECM and connectors for any damage.
- Program the new ECM to fit the car's needs.

Related Error Codes on Volkswagen
To fix problems with Volkswagen's electronic control module (ECM), it's helpful to understand related error codes. These codes, like P0606, suggest issues with the ECM. Codes such as P0605 or P0607 point to specific ECM troubles. P0605 may mean there's a memory issue, while P0607 suggests performance problems.
These codes can show whether the ECM is causing problems in other parts of the car. Other codes like P0218 or P0420 might appear, hinting at issues with engine temperature or the catalytic converter.
Checking these codes together gives a clearer picture of what's happening with the car's electronics and engine. This way, mechanics can find and fix the real problem, avoiding more issues later on.
